Address

ecash:qrukl5mvlg2w45qwdqajszvxn66r3kkn65m55v0z0vCopy

Total Received

53650298.03 XEC

Total Sent

53650298.03 XEC

№ Transactions

340

Final Balance

0 XEC

Transactions
Filter